Rear Drive Shaft: Assembly
CAUTION:
Wrap shaft splines with vinyl tape to protect the boot from scratches.
NOTE:
Use specified grease.
Grease:
EDJ, DOJ side: NKG814
BJ side, DOJ side: NKG814
- Install the BJ or EBJ boot in specified position on the shaft assembly, and fill it with 50 - 60 g (1.76-2.12 oz) of specified grease.
- Install the DOJ inner race to the shaft.
- Install the DOJ or EDJ boot onto shaft.
- Insert the cage onto shaft.NOTE: Insert the cage with the cutout portion facing the shaft end, since the cage has an orientation.
- Install the inner race on shaft and fix the snap ring in place with pliers.NOTE: Confirm that the snap ring is completely fitted in the shaft groove.
- Install the cage, which is already inserted into the shaft assembly to the inner race.
- Install the cage (B) with the protruding section aligned with the track on the inner race (A), and turn by a half pitch.
- Fill 80 - 90 g (2.82-3.17 oz) of specified grease into the inner side of the DOJ or EDJ outer race.
- Apply a thin coat of specified grease to the cage pocket and ball.
- Insert the ball bearings into the cage pocket.
- Connect the outer race to the shaft assembly.
- Align the outer race track and ball positions, and place the shaft, inner race, cage and ball bearings in the original positions, and then fix outer race in place.
- Install the snap ring in the groove on the DOJ outer race.CAUTION: Be careful of the following items during installation:
- Make sure that the balls, cage and inner race are completely fitted in the outer race of DOJ.
- Use care not to place the matched position of snap ring in the ball groove of outer race.
- Pull the shaft lightly and assure that the circlip is completely fitted in the groove.
- Apply an even coat of the specified grease [20 - 30 g (0.71-1.06 oz)] to the entire inner surface of boot. Also apply grease to the shaft.
- Install the DOJ boot and EDJ boot taking care not to twist it.
NOTE:- The inside of the large end of DOJ or EDJ boot and the boot groove shall be cleaned so as to be free from grease and other substances.
- When installing the DOJ or EDJ boot, position the outer race of DOJ or EDJ boot at center of the stroke.
- Tighten the boot band. (double loop type)CAUTION:
- Be careful not to damage the boot.
- When tightening boot, use care so that the air within the boot is appropriate.
- Once assembled, extend and retract the DOJ repeatedly to provide an equal coating of grease.
- Put a new band through the clip and wind twice in the band groove of the boot.
- Pinch the end of band with pliers. Hold the clip and tighten securely.
- Tighten the band using the ST.NOTE: Tighten the band until it cannot be moved by hand.
Preparation tool:
ST: BAND TIGHTENING TOOL (925091000)
- Tap the clip with the punch provided at the end of the ST.NOTE: Tap to an extent that the boot underneath is not damaged.
Preparation tool:
ST: BAND TIGHTENING TOOL (925091000)
- Cut off the band with an allowance of about 10 mm (0.39 in) left from the clip and bend this allowance over the clip.CAUTION: Make sure that the end of the band is in close contact with clip.
- Tighten the boot band. (locking tab type)CAUTION:
- Be careful not to damage the boot.
- When tightening boot, use care so that the air within the boot is appropriate.
- Once assembled, extend and retract the DOJ repeatedly to provide an equal coating of grease.
Preparation tool:
Needle nose pliers
- Place a new band onto the groove of the boot.
- Pinch (e) and (d) of the band with needle nose pliers, and align with the convex claw (c) for temporarily tightening position.
- Keep tightening until claw (a) is seen through the claw window (f) and hold.
- While holding the end of the band, hook the claw (a) with the claw window (f).
- Make sure the claw (a) and claw (b) are both securely engage to the claw window.
- Extend and retract the DOJ or EDJ repeatedly to provide an equal coating of grease.
